Our carefully curated vintage hand-knotted runners from southeastern Turkey and northern Iraq showcase the region's rich weaving traditions, combining cultural motifs with vibrant and earthy tones. Woven in the late 20th century, each runner is a unique piece of art, crafted meticulously by skilled artisans using traditional methods passed down through generations.
The designs often feature
geometric patterns,
symbolic motifs, and a harmonious blend of colors, reflecting the natural landscapes and cultural heritage of the area. These runners not only serve as functional pieces but also as a testament to the enduring legacy of tribal craftsmanship, adding a touch of history and elegance to any space.

Symbolism of Main Motifs
- Geometric Shapes
- Reflect traditional beliefs in geometry as representing harmony and the connection between the physical and spiritual worlds.
- Often used to ward off evil spirits, displaying protection and strength.
- Floral Elements
- Symbolize nature and the cycle of life, celebrated in various cultures as representations of beauty and growth.
- Associated with hospitality and abundance, reflecting a warm welcome to guests.
